Unlike Western fashion magazines that often prescribe looks detached from local realities, Naari acknowledges the multifaceted life of its reader. One editorial spread might feature a powerful essay on the revival of handloom weaving in Bangladesh or India, showcasing a model in a timeless, hand-embroided phulkari dupatta. The very next page could present a photo shoot of tailored blazers and cigarette trousers, styled for the corporate woman navigating a glass-ceilinged boardroom. This juxtaposition is intentional. The magazine argues that style is not about discarding tradition for Western wear, but about curating a wardrobe that serves different facets of a woman’s life—her home, her workplace, her festive celebrations, and her individual aspirations.

The region's unique tribal heritage is also influencing mainstream fashion. Events like the Tatapani Mahotsav have featured dazzling tribal fashion walks, bringing the state's indigenous customs and clothing into the limelight. Naari Magazine, by covering such events and the work of local designers like Dolly Badwani and Sanjana Baghel, connects its readers to a fashion movement that is both locally rooted and globally aware.
